Creamy pesto chicken 🍗

Creamy pesto chicken 🍗 is a easy Italian-American recipe that serves 2. 450 calories per serving. Recipe by Frida on YouTube.

Prep: 10 min | Cook: 15 min | Total: 30 min

Cost: $8.98 total, $4.49 per serving

Ingredients

  • 2 pieces Chicken Breast (boneless, skinless, about 1 lb total, trimmed)
  • 1 tablespoon Avocado Oil (high smoke point oil)
  • 1 medium Bell Pepper (any color, diced)
  • 2 cloves Garlic (minced)
  • 0.5 cup Chicken Broth (low‑sodium)
  • 0.5 cup Heavy Cream (35 % fat)
  • 2 tablespoons Pesto (store‑bought or homemade)
  • 0.25 cup Parmesan Cheese (freshly grated)
  • 0.5 cup Mozzarella Cheese (shredded)
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t (to taste)
  • 0.25 teaspoon Black Pepper (freshly ground)

Instructions

  1. Prepare Ingredients

    Dice the bell pepper and mince the garlic. Measure the broth, cream, pesto, Parmesan, and mozzarella so they are ready to use.

    Time: PT5M

  2. Cook Chicken

    Heat avocado oil in a large skillet over medium‑high heat. Season the chicken breasts with salt and pepper, add to the skillet, and cook 6‑7 minutes per side until the internal temperature reaches 165°F.

    Time: PT8M

  3. Remove Chicken

    Transfer the cooked chicken to a plate and set aside while you make the sauce.

    Time: PT0M

  4. Make Sauce

    In the same skillet, add the minced garlic and diced bell pepper. Sauté for about 2 minutes until fragrant. Pour in the chicken broth and heavy cream, whisk continuously, and bring to a gentle simmer for 3 minutes.

    Time: PT5M

  5. Add Pesto and Parmesan

    Stir in the pesto and grated Parmesan cheese until the sauce thickens, about 1 minute.

    Time: PT2M

  6. Combine and Bake

    Return the chicken to the skillet, sprinkle the shredded mozzarella over the top, and place the skillet in a pre‑heated oven at 375°F. Bake for 5 minutes, until the cheese is melted and lightly bubbling.

    Time: PT5M

    Temperature: 375°F

  7. Serve

    Remove from the oven, let rest 2 minutes, then slice the chicken and serve over rice, pasta, or a simple green salad. Garnish with fresh basil if desired.

    Time: PT0M

Critical Success Points

  • Cook chicken until internal temperature reaches 165°F.
  • Whisk broth and cream together and bring to a gentle simmer to create a smooth sauce.
  • Bake with mozzarella until the cheese melts and bubbles, ensuring the sauce stays creamy.

Safety Warnings

  • Handle the hot skillet with oven mitts to avoid burns.
  • Make sure the chicken reaches a safe internal temperature of 165°F.
  • Use a timer when the skillet is in the oven to prevent over‑browning.

Q

What are the most common mistakes to avoid when making creamy pesto chicken?

A

Common errors include overcooking the chicken, which makes it dry, and adding the cream at too high a heat, which can cause it to curdle. Also, failing to scrape the browned bits from the pan will result in a less flavorful sauce.

technical
Q

Why does this creamy pesto chicken recipe use avocado oil for searing instead of olive oil?

A

Avocado oil has a higher smoke point than most olive oils, allowing the chicken to develop a golden crust without burning the oil, while still providing a neutral flavor that lets the pesto shine.

technical
Q

Can I make creamy pesto chicken ahead of time and how should I store it?

A

Yes. Prepare the sauce up to step 5, let it cool, and refrigerate. Add the mozzarella and bake just before serving. Store the cooked chicken and sauce separately in airtight containers for up to 3 days in the fridge.
